I am currently using the logical decoding feature (version 9.6 I think as far as I found in the source, wal_level: logical, max_replication_slot: > 1, track_commit_timestamp: on, I am not sure whether this will help or not).
Following the online documentation, everything works fine until I input

SELECT * FROM pg_logical_slot_peek_changes('regression_slot', NULL, NULL, 'include-timestamp', 'on');


I always got 1999-12-31 16:00 as the commit time for arbitrary transactions with DML statements. After several tries, I realize that the txn->commit_time returned was always 0. Could you help me by indicating me what could be wrong in my case? Any missing parameters set?
